Transaction 735471e293fc16764d9b07409a8b1fd425cfe737ed470c6ae842f19d99aad88e

block
dbc8b1a00fe543834621acfc683261908f64a3784aec887221905b0c9ad57ca2

18 Inputs

2 Outputs